Proverbs 19:5

A false witness will not go unpunished, and whoever pours out lies will not go free.

I was reading this one just a few days ago

Provers 6:16-19

There are six things the Lord hates, seven that are detestable to him:
17 haughty eyes, a lying tongue, hands that shed innocent blood,
18 a heart that devises wicked schemes, feet that are quick to rush into evil,
19 a false witness who pours out lies and a person who stirs up conflict in the community.
